Main features updated in this system software beta version
• In Messages, you can now turn notifications on or off for each of the groups you're in. On the group screen, open the options menu and select  Turn Notifications Off.

Other update features 
• On the game session details screen, you can now use the Request to Join button to ask the session leader to join their game session. The session leader can then send you an invite to join the game session.
• When playing a game you've hidden, other players will no longer see that you're currently playing that game.
• The Communities feature is no longer available.

I've got the digital edition and as soon as its turned on it makes a constant whine noise - start a game and it stops whilst you play the game, then come back out to the menus or go into the media app to watch apple tv and the whine continues the whole time you watch something.

 

It's quite annoying and makes watching anything using the streaming apps (netflix, apple tv etc) not very enticing as although the picture quality is great the noise is a constant distraction - even my other half notices it and she's normally immune to these mystery noises I hear the whole time.
